Pora Chingra
Pora Chingra is a village located in Bhagawanpur Ii sub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Mugberia are the district & sub-district headquarters of Pora Chingra village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Garbari I is the gram panchayat of Pora Chingra village.

About Pora Chingra
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Pora Chingra is 345206. The village spans a total geographical area of 282.83 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721655. Contai is nearest town to Pora Chingra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 32km away.

Population of Pora Chingra
According to the 2011 Census, Pora Chingra has a total population of about 2,709, with approximately 1,418 males and 1,291 females. The sex ratio is around 910 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 322 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 161 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 82.32%, with male literacy at about 85.47% and female literacy near 78.85%. There are around 711 households in the village. Connectivity of Pora Chingra
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Pora Chingra. As per the 2011 stats, Pora Chingra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
